A Product Development Manager leads new product ideation and development of early learning games and toys. In this role, a product manager will shepherd new products through all phases of development including research, manage consumer surveys, develop criteria for new product designs, and lead early production processes including: KeyShot renderings for presentations and marketing assets, rapid prototyping, testing, and manufacturing. Product managers lead innovative brainstorms, work with cross-functional teams and manage overseas manufacturers.
Scope of Responsibilities:
The individual in this role will:
Key lead in early product concept designs and testing through KeyShot, Adobe, CAD programs.
Manage stage-gate processes for product design buy-in from major stakeholders
Manage competitive research, ideation, vendor relations, preparation of detailed RFQs, content development, and testing to meet quality standards
Identify solutions to improve processes by collaborating with other functional teams to meet or beat deadlines and budgets
Evaluate product/line strengths and weaknesses, confirming that they support the overall brand and current needs of our customers and end users
Lead new product concepting and present products during annual line review process
Stay abreast of current market needs and trends especially as they affect areas of responsibility
Work with key individuals (QC/ Safety, Purchasing, Marketing, Sales, E-commerce) to ensure that all new and current products are being effectively marketed to customers and end-users
Work with the Creative and Marketing teams to manage the creation of activity guides, videos, and other resources that extend the play and add to the product's value
